| A | B | 
|---|
| metals | these are good conductors | 
| battery | A device that changes chemical energy into electricity is a _____. | 
| attract | Electricity flows because opposite charges _____. | 
| generator | makes electricity from motion | 
| volt | measure of voltage | 
| conductor | allows  electricity to move | 
| circuit | a closed (complete) path that allows  current to flow. | 
| series | one after another | 
| current | is the continuous flow of electrons | 
| static | electrons staying in place | 
| insulator | stops electron flow | 
| resistor | slows electron flow | 
| voltage | like pressure in electricity | 
| current | like water from a faucet | 
| resistance | like friction for electrons | 
| parallel | next to each other on separate branches | 
| source | battery or generator | 
| Ohm's Law | relates voltage, current, and resistance | 
| ohm | measure of resistance | 
| ampere | measure of current | 
| device | uses electricity. |
